About the Opportunity

We are seeking an experienced and results-driven Warehouse and Operations Manager – Full time Permanent to lead our warehouse operations in Oakleigh South, Victoria. Reporting to the General Manager, you will manage day-to-day warehouse activities, oversee staff performance, and ensure compliance with HACCP and OH&S standards. Your leadership will drive productivity, accuracy, and premium customer service through DIFOT.

In this Role

You will be leading a team responsible for, but not  limited to:

  • Lead by example in safety practices, setting clear standards, expectations, and fostering a strong safety culture in line with OH&S requirements.
  • Optimize picking operations to ensure high pick rates and order accuracy across all shifts.
  • Maintain accurate inventory records through regular audits, cycle counts, and system updates.
  • Streamline the receipting and putaway process to ensure goods are efficiently logged, inspected, and stored upon arrival.
  • Ensure end-to-end order fulfillment excellence , from picking and packing to dispatch, meeting customer expectations and service level agreements.
  • Uphold facility compliance with HACCP standards and Occupational Health & Safety regulations, particularly in food handling or temperature-controlled environments.
  • Collaborate with key stakeholders to ensure seamless shift handovers and consistent workflow across departments.
  • Drive team performance through engagement, motivation, feedback, and recognition of achievements.
  • Invest in team development through structured training programs, coaching, and long-term career growth opportunities.
  • Continuously improve warehouse operations by evaluating current processes, identifying inefficiencies, and implementing innovative solutions to enhance productivity and efficiency.
  • Coordinate rostering and payroll accuracy for all shifts
